Help police in tracing missing Sopore boy

INS Correspondent by INS Correspondent
August 29, 2018
A A
Police seeks help in tracing missing
Share on FacebookShare on TwitterWhatsappTelegramEmail

RELATED POSTS

DIG Sharma visits annual mela at Baba Bhudan Shah Ji Ziarat

PDD daily wager dies after fall from electric pole in Achabal

At 23.2°C, Sgr records 4th all-time highest night temp in 134 years

Sopore: Police on Wednesday called upon general public to help them trace a boy who has been missing since Aug 26.
“Zubair Ahmad Dar (aged about 18 years), s/o Ghulam Mohammad Dar  R/O Haritar Sopore went out from home on 26 August 2018 and has not returned back,” police said.
In this regard a missing report has been registered in Police Station Tarzoo and search to trace out the missing boy has been started.
